Solve for x and y
y = 2x + 1
y = 4x - 1

Answer:

y=3 x=1

Step-by-step explanation:

Let's solve your equation step-by-step.

2x+1=4x−1

Step 1: Subtract 4x from both sides.

2x+1−4x=4x−1−4x

−2x+1=−1

Step 2: Subtract 1 from both sides.

−2x+1−1=−1−1

−2x=−2

Step 3: Divide both sides by -2.

x=1

then

y=(2)(1)+1

Answer:

y=3
